Minutes — Management Meeting, Greyfell Tooling

Attendees: senior management; circulated to sales leads.

The licensing dispute with Ossmere Components was discussed. Counsel advises our use of the Vantrel process predates their filing. Settlement talks resume next week; sales should pause quoting Vantrel-based products until then. Potential outcomes and their bearing on our plans are summarised confidentially below.

confidential, yahip-hagug: Gorixax Logistics plans to lower the Ulaael list price by 26.6 percent in October. The pricing group signed off on a budget of $199.9 million for Project Holix. The renewal with Kasdorox Systems closes at $137.5 million a year, 8.2 percent above the last contract. Project Lamion slips by a full year because of the audit delay.

// Watchdog for the Brimvale kiosk shell (project Larkspur).
// If the foreground app stops heartbeating, we kill and relaunch it;
// after three failed relaunches we reboot the unit. Timings below were
// tuned against the fleet in the Quellford pilot — do not loosen them
// without a soak test, since overly patient values masked the freeze
// bug we shipped in 4.2. Release builds must keep reboot enabled.
// The current tuning constants are as follows.

tuning table, yajog-yahof:
BUDGETS = {
    "lamvan": 303,
    "wenox": 460,
    "fenvan": 525,
}

Ticket: Dark-mode support — Ostervane admin dashboard. The theme toggle persists its state in a cookie readable by embedded widgets; security review requested before merge. Dark palette itself is complete and contrast-checked. Reviewer should confirm the cookie carries no session-linked data and that the widget sandbox can't infer admin activity from theme flips. The reviewed build is identified by the token below.

session token of bahip-hawep = htk4_b0c1

## Transcode Farm: Worker Bring-Up

Each Quillback transcode worker authenticates to the Marrowgate job queue before accepting segments. Verify the worker runs as the unprivileged `qbx` account, that scratch volumes are mounted noexec, and that the watchdog interval is 15 seconds or less. Audit logging must be enabled prior to credential injection. With those checks complete, edit the worker's env file and place the queue access token on the following line.

sealed setting: VAULT_KEY13=741e0a90de233